A quickfire double from Lauren Hemp saw City come from behind to beat Aston Villa 2-1 and move up to second in the Barclays Women’s Super League. The visitors had taken an early lead when Danielle Turner cleverly hooked an effort into the top corner of the City net. But two goals in the space of five second-half minutes from Hemp turned the game on its head at the Joie Stadium.
It means City sign off on home soil for 2023 with another hard fought triumph, and having lost just once at the Joie Stadium this year.
